2

用c#从头写一个AI agent,实现企业内部自然语言数据统计分析(二)-数据结构和代码分析方法

1、数据结构 下面是本文中用到的数据表结构,主要是保存聊天历史,操作日志,agent定义以及定时提醒用的。结构简单,不做过多说明。 2、代码分析方法 接下来的内容,我打算使用一种以“实现具体需求为目的”的方法来描述在上文中提到的一些工作。这种方法目的性强,便于读者快速了解需要的内容,但又不会太繁琐。 ...

chegan 发布于 2025-04-27 19:42 评论(0)阅读(494)
0

[python] 基于WatchDog库实现文件系统监控

Watchdog库是Python中一个用于监控文件系统变化的第三方库。它能够实时监测文件或目录的创建、修改、删除等操作,并在这些事件发生时触发相应的处理逻辑,因此也被称为文件看门狗。 Watchdog库的官方仓库见:watchdog,Watchdog库的官方文档见:watchdog-doc。Watc ...

落痕的寒假 发布于 2025-04-27 19:33 评论(0)阅读(342)
2

GitLab CI/CD 的配置文件 .gitlab-ci.yml 简介

.gitlab-ci.yml 文件主要用于项目的自动化部署配置,自动化可以大大提升团队效率,但同时这个文件的内容也比较复杂,弄清楚也并非易事,本文将对此文件的内容进行简单介绍,供参考。 ...

橙子家 发布于 2025-04-27 18:14 评论(2)阅读(803)
0

[设计模式/Java] 设计模式之解释器模式【27】

概述:解释器模式 := Interpreter Pattern ∈ 行为型模式 模式定义 解释器模式(Interpreter Pattern)提供了评估语言的语法或表达式的方式 属于行为型模式。 解释器模式给定一个语言,定义它的文法的一种表示,并定义一个解释器,这个解释器使用该表示来解释语言中的句子 ...

千千寰宇 发布于 2025-04-27 18:05 评论(0)阅读(221)
1

痞子衡嵌入式:在含多个i.MXRT的主从系统中共享一颗Flash启动的方法与实践(上篇)

大家好,我是痞子衡,是正经搞技术的痞子。今天痞子衡给大家介绍的是多个i.MXRT共享一颗Flash启动的方法。 有些特殊的客户应用会采用多颗 i.MXRT 芯片设计一主多从的硬件架构(目的不一,或仿多核 MCU 系统、或拓展 GPIO 数量),因为 i.MXRT 片内无非易失性存储器,这时候为整个系 ...

痞子衡 发布于 2025-04-27 17:06 评论(0)阅读(159)
1

打造企业级AI文案助手:GPT-J+Flask全栈开发实战

AI文案助手不仅解放了内容生产者的双手,更重塑了营销创意的生成方式。通过本文的实践,开发者可以快速构建企业级内容中台,让AI成为最得力的创意伙伴。建议从电商行业入手,逐步扩展到金融、教育等领域,见证生成式AI的商业魔力。 ...

TechSynapse 发布于 2025-04-27 16:53 评论(0)阅读(292)
1

ESP32教程:通过WIFI控制LED灯的开关

LED闪烁 在通过WIFI控制LED灯的开关之前,我们先实现一下LED闪烁。 接线图: 来源:https://esp32io.com/tutorials/esp32-led-blink 我的接线图: LED长的为阳极,短的为阴极,阳极通过一个电阻与ESP32引脚连接,这里以18引脚为例,阴极连接ES ...

mingupupup 发布于 2025-04-27 16:39 评论(0)阅读(426)
5

PC端自动化测试实战教程-3-pywinauto 启动PC端应用程序 - 下篇(详细教程)

1.简介 经过上一篇的学习、介绍和了解,pywinauto的强大,不言而喻吧!宏哥讲解和分享的是电脑自带和安装的应用程序。有些小伙伴或者童鞋们已经迫不及待地私信宏哥,如果在电脑中这个应用程序已经启用了,我如何去启动这个已经启动的应用程序呢?各位别急,宏哥今天就会讲解和分享如何启动PC端已经启动的应用 ...

北京-宏哥 发布于 2025-04-27 16:36 评论(0)阅读(248)
0

银河麒麟v10 sysctl内核参数加载顺序的思考

背景 最近很多伙伴想使用银河麒麟高级服务器系统v10来部署最新版本的k8s集群,可能遇到了各式各样的问题,于是准备使用kylinOS v10重温一遍kubeadm部署最新版本k8s的流程,也是替大家踩踩坑。 在进行服务器基础配置优化时,到内核参数修改这一步,引发了一些新的思考。 过程 在修改内核参数 ...

塔克拉玛攻城狮 发布于 2025-04-27 16:08 评论(0)阅读(270)
14

springboot分页查询并行优化实践

——基于异步优化与 MyBatis-Plus 分页插件思想的实践 适用场景 数据量较大的单表分页查询 较复杂的多表关联查询,包含group by等无法进行count优化较耗时的分页查询 技术栈 核心框架:Spring Boot + MyBatis-Plus 异步编程:JDK 8+ 的 Complet ...

字节悦动 发布于 2025-04-27 15:56 评论(0)阅读(577)
5

服务器时间漂移,如何开启Linux NTP自动同步

前言 在日常服务器运维中,我们往往默认服务器的时间是精准的。但最近一次偶然的 date 查询,让我发现——服务器时间竟然悄悄地漂移了…… 本文记录了整个排查与解决的过程,希望能帮到遇到类似问题的朋友,也为自己留下一份系统化的成长笔记。 发现问题 我最近在开发 StarBlog 的访问分析功能,但发现 ...

程序设计实验室 发布于 2025-04-27 15:36 评论(4)阅读(562)
0

Bagging、Boosting、Stacking的原理

Bagging、Boosting、Stacking是常见集成学习的形式,它们都是通过对多个学习器进行有机组合,达到比单个学习器性能更好的目标。 一、Bagging 1.算法概述 Bagging(Bootstrap Aggregating)算法即自助聚合算法,是一种基于统计学习理论的集成学习算法,主要 ...

归去_来兮 发布于 2025-04-27 15:15 评论(0)阅读(290)
8

微服务之间有哪些调用方式?

随着微服务架构的广泛应用,服务之间的通信方式成为了系统设计中的重要一环。微服务的核心理念是将系统拆分为多个独立的服务,每个服务负责特定的业务功能。为了实现这些服务之间的协作,通信方式的选择至关重要。 微服务之间的通信方式主要分为两大类: 同步通信:服务之间直接调用,通常需要立即返回结果。 异步通信: ...

代码拾光 发布于 2025-04-27 15:04 评论(1)阅读(1626)
0

n8n 快速入门

今天,我将为大家介绍一个当前非常流行的可视化智能体搭建平台——n8n。n8n(发音为 "n-eight-n")是一个强大的自动化工具,它能够帮助您轻松地将任何具有API的应用程序与其他应用程序进行连接,并通过最少的代码或甚至无需编写代码来实现数据的自动化流转。 n8n的核心特点之一是高度可定制,它提 ...

努力的小雨 发布于 2025-04-27 13:54 评论(3)阅读(1206)
2

.NET AI从0开始入门 SemanticKernel 从基础到实践

引言 本教程将带你全面了解SemanticKernel,一款强大的AI开发工具包。以下内容基于实际代码示例,帮助你快速掌握使用技巧。 资源链接: 教程代码仓库:https://github.com/AIDotNet/SemanticKernel.Samples QQ交流群:961090189 微信交 ...

239573049 发布于 2025-04-27 13:34 评论(0)阅读(579)
1

解锁UV工具新玩法:让Python脚本运行更高效的实用技巧

作为Python开发者,你是否经常被依赖安装的漫长等待、虚拟环境的繁琐管理,或是脚本分享时“环境不一致”的问题困扰? 近年来,一款名为UV的工具悄然兴起,它不仅以极速安装依赖著称,更通过一系列创新设计重构了Python脚本的运行逻辑。 本文主要介绍UV的三大实用技巧,从“依赖即代码”到“动态环境隔离 ...

wang_yb 发布于 2025-04-27 12:23 评论(0)阅读(1227)
1

小模型工具调用能力激活:以Qwen2.5 0.5B为例的Prompt工程实践

**本文以Qwen2.5 0.5B为例**,展示如何通过精心设计的prompt激发其工具调用能力,为开发者提供实用指导。 ...

松哥_ai_自动化 发布于 2025-04-27 11:16 评论(0)阅读(426)
4

C# 使用StackExchange.Redis实现分布式锁的两种方式

分布式锁在集群的架构中发挥着重要的作用。以下有主要的使用场景 1.在秒杀、抢购等高并发场景下,多个用户同时下单同一商品,可能导致库存超卖。 2.支付、转账等金融操作需保证同一账户的资金变动是串行执行的。 3.分布式环境下,多个节点可能同时触发同一任务(如定时报表生成)。 4.用户因网络延迟重复提交表 ...

BruceNeter 发布于 2025-04-27 10:58 评论(2)阅读(827)
0

鸿蒙动画与交互设计:ArkUI 3D变换与手势事件详解

大家好,我是 V 哥。 在鸿蒙 NEXT 开发中,ArkUI 提供了丰富的 3D 变换和手势事件功能,可用于创建生动且交互性强的用户界面。下面详细介绍 ArkUI 的 3D 变换和手势事件,并给出相应的 ArkTS 案例代码。 1. ArkUI 3D 变换 ArkUI 支持多种 3D 变换效果,如旋 ...

威哥爱编程 发布于 2025-04-27 10:24 评论(0)阅读(277)
0

单据污染解决方案

一、单据污染解决方案 感觉本篇对你有帮助可以关注一下我的微信公众号(深入浅出谈java),会不定期更新知识和面试资料、技巧!!! 什么是数据污染? 单据数据污染是指业务单据在存储、传输或处理过程中,由于异常操作、系统缺陷或外部干扰,导致数据被错误修改、覆盖或破坏,最终影响数据的准确性、完整性和可靠性 ...

古渡蓝按 发布于 2025-04-27 09:32 评论(0)阅读(280)